G-DEVS/HLA Environment for Distributed Simulations of Workflows

We present a Workflow environment allowing distributed simulation based on DEVS/G-DEVS formalisms. A description language for Workflow processes and an automatic transformation of a Workflow into a G-DEVS model have been defined. We then introduce a new distributed Workflow Reference Model with HLA-compliant Workflow components. We detail the HLA objects shared between Workflow federates and present the publishing/subscribing status of each of these federates. Finally, we illustrate the use of this distributed environment with an example of a Microelectronic production Workflow.

Key Words: Workflow • DEVS • G-DEVS • validation • XML • distributed simulation • interoperability • HLA
